What is Real Estate Management?
Property management is the operation, control, maintenance, and oversight of real estate and physical property. This can include residential, commercial, and land real estate.
Where Can I Study Real Estate Management In South Africa?
Three universities in South Africa offer degree courses in Real Estate: the universities of Witwatersrand, Pretoria, and Cape Town.
Cape Peninsula University of Technology also offers a diploma course in Real Estate.

What degree is best for real estate Management?
A business degree is an ideal degree for someone working for a business or a new business owner. Real estate is a business, which makes the courses offered in a business degree very valuable.
Business students take courses in business ethics, business management, business laws, marketing, and economics, to name a few.
